AimTo verify whether arterial stiffness and endothelial dysfunction influence lower limb muscle strength and gait speed in older adults with type 2 diabetes mellitus (T2DM).MethodsCross-sectional study including seventy-eight older adults with T2DM (aged 67 ± 6 years and 42 % male). Arterial stiffness was assessed using pulse wave velocity (PWV), while endothelial function was measured by flow-mediated dilation (FMD). Lower limb muscle strength and gait speed were assessed using the 30-second chair stand test (30s-CST) and 10-Meter Walk Test, respectively.ResultsBoth PWV (m/s) and FMD (%) were univariately associated with number of repetitions in 30s-CST and gait speed (P < 0.05). After control for age, sex and body mass index, PWV remained associated with repetitions in 30s-CST (95 % CI: ?0.494 to ?0.054; P = 0.015) and gait speed (95 % CI: ?0.039 to ?0.002; P = 0.031). After adjustments for control variables, T2DM duration and glycemic control, FMD was associated with repetitions in 30s-CST (95 % CI: 0.008 to 0.324; P = 0.039) and gait speed (95 % CI: 0.011 to 0.038; P = 0.001).ConclusionIn older adults with T2DM, both arterial stiffness and endothelial dysfunction are associated with decreased leg muscle strength and slower gait speed.  相似文献

BackgroundThe clinical importance of postoperative hyperamylasemia (POHA) grade is unknown. Our objectives were to evaluate the association of POHA grade with clinically relevant postoperative pancreatic fistula (CR-POPF) and compare its prognostic utility against postoperative day 1 drain fluid amylase (DFA-1).MethodsPatients who underwent pancreatectomy from January 2019 through March 2020 were identified in the ACS NSQIP pancreatectomy-targeted dataset. POHA grade was assigned using post-operative serum amylase and clinical sequelae. The primary outcome was CR-POPF within 30 days. The association of POHA grade with CR-POPF was assessed using multivariable logistic regression, and c-statistics were used to compare POHA grade versus DFA-1.ResultsPOHA occurred in 520 patients at 98 hospitals, including 261 (50.2%) with grade A, 234 (45.0%) with grade B, and 25 (4.8%) with grade C POHA. CR-POPFs were increased among patients with grade B (66.2%, OR 9.28 [5.84–14.73]) and C (68.0%, OR 10.50 [3.77–29.26]) versus grade A POHA (19.2%). POHA-inclusive models better predicted CR-POPF than those with DFA-1 alone (p < 0.002) and models with both predictors outperformed POHA alone (p = 0.039).ConclusionPOHA grade represents a measure of post-pancreatectomy outcomes that predicts CR-POPF and outperforms DFA-1 but must be aligned with new international definitions.  相似文献

ObjectiveThere may be gender difference in correlation of diabetes mellitus (DM) and cardiovascular events. We attempt to investigate whether there is gender-heterogeneity in one-year outcomes of atrial fibrillation (AF) patients with DM or not.MethodsPatients who were diagnosed with AF admitted to the emergency departments in the Chinese AF Multicenter Registry study were enrolled. Basic demographics information, initial Blood Pressure and heart rate, medical histories, and treatments of each patient were collected. Follow-up was carried out with a mean duration of one year. The primary endpoint was all-cause mortality and systemic embolism.ResultsA total of 2016 patients were selected from September 2008 and April 2011. All-cause mortality was significantly higher in male AF patients with DM than those without (21.8 % & 13.6 %, P = 0.014). Cox regression analysis showed that there was an interaction between gender and DM for one-year all-cause mortality (P = 0.049). DM was significantly associated with one-year all-cause mortality regardless of univariate analysis (HR = 1.436, 95%CI:1.079–1.911, P = 0.013) or multivariate analysis (HR = 1.418, 95%CI: 1.059–1.899, P = 0.019). For male patients with AF, DM was significantly associated with one-year all-cause mortality (P = 0.048), but not for female patients with AF (P = 0.362).ConclusionDM was independently associated with one-year all-cause mortality in the entire cohort of AF patients. This association was found mainly in male patients with AF, but not in female patients. DM management programs may need to reflect gender difference.  相似文献
